SPRINGFIELDThe Illinois Department of Public Health (IDPH) announced today that it has learned of three suspected cases of severe hepatitis in children under ten years of age, potentially linked to a strain of adenovirus. Two of the cases are in suburban Chicago and one is in Western Illinois. One case resulted in a liver transplant. IDPH is working to learn of other suspected cases in Illinois and is asking healthcare providers in the state to be on the lookout for symptoms and to report any suspected cases of hepatitis in children of unknown origin to local public health authorities.

The IDPH announcement follows a nationwide alert issued by the CDC in response to a cluster of nine cases of hepatitis of unknown origin in children in Alabama ranging in age from 1 to 6 years old, all of whom were previously healthy.

The CDC said that symptoms of hepatitis, or inflammation of the liver, include fever, fatigue, loss of appetite, nausea, vomiting, abdominal pain, dark urine, light-colored stools, joint pain, and jaundice and can be caused by viruses. These cases appear to have an association with adenovirus 41. Adenoviruses spread from person-to-person and most commonly cause respiratory illness, but depending on the type, can also cause other illnesses such as gastroenteritis (inflammation of the stomach or intestines), conjunctivitis (pink eye), and cystitis (bladder infection). Adenovirus type 41 typically presents as diarrhea, vomiting and fever, and is often accompanied by respiratory symptoms. While there have been case reports of hepatitis in immunocompromised children with adenovirus infection, adenovirus type 41 is not known to be a cause of hepatitis in otherwise healthy children.

CDC said it is working with state health departments to see if there are additional U.S. cases, and what may be causing these cases. At this time, CDC said it believes adenovirus may be the cause for these reported cases, but investigators are still learning more – including ruling out other possible causes and identifying other possible contributing factors.

CDC is asking physicians to consider adenovirus testing using PCR or NAAT on respiratory samples, stool or rectal swabs and whole blood for pediatric patients with hepatitis of unknown etiology, and to report any possible cases of hepatitis of unknown origin to CDC and state public health authorities.

In addition, CDC is encouraging parents and caregivers to be aware of the symptoms of hepatitis, and to contact their healthcare provider with any concerns. CDC continues to recommend children be up to date on all their vaccinations, and that parents and caregivers of young children take the same everyday preventive actions that it recommends for everyone, including washing hands often, avoiding people who are sick, covering coughs and sneezes, and avoiding touching the eyes, nose or mouth.

[TD="width: 100%"]Wisconsin DHS Health Alert #42: Recommendations for Adenovirus Testing and Reporting of Children with Acute Hepatitis of Unknown Etiology


Bureau of Communicable Diseases

April 27, 2022

Summary


The Wisconsin Department of Health Services (DHS) is issuing this Health Alert Network (HAN) Health Advisory to notify clinicians and public health authorities of a recent increase in cases of acute hepatitis and adenovirus infection in children.

From November 2021 to February 2022, clinicians at a large children’s hospital in Alabama identified nine pediatric patients with significant liver injury, including three with acute liver failure, who also tested positive for adenovirus. All children were previously healthy. All five of the nine specimens that were sequenced had adenovirus type 41 infection identified. Two patients required liver transplant; no patients died.

Since being notified of this adenovirus-associated hepatitis cluster, DHS is now investigating at least four similar cases among children in Wisconsin. This includes two children who had severe outcomes, one liver transplant, and one fatality.
Background


A possible association between pediatric hepatitis and adenovirus infection in children who tested negative for hepatitis viruses A, B, C, D, and E is currently under investigation worldwide. This Health Alert serves to notify U.S. clinicians who may encounter pediatric patients with hepatitis of unknown etiology to consider adenovirus testing and to elicit reporting of such cases to state public health authorities and to the Centers for Disease Control and Prevention (CDC). Nucleic acid amplification testing (NAAT, e.g., PCR) is preferred for adenovirus detection and may be performed on respiratory specimens, stool or rectal swabs, or blood.

CDC issued an official Health Advisory describing a cluster of cases in Alabama and provided recommendations for testing and reporting on April 21. The World Health Organization has also published a Disease Outbreak News report on April 23 describing 169 cases of acute hepatitis of unknown etiology, of these, adenovirus had been detected in at least 74 cases.

Clinical


Hepatitis is inflammation of the liver that can be caused by viral infections, alcohol use, toxins, medications, and certain other medical conditions. In the U.S, the most common causes of viral hepatitis are hepatitis A, hepatitis B, and hepatitis C viruses.

Signs and symptoms of hepatitis include fever, fatigue, loss of appetite, nausea, vomiting, abdominal pain, dark urine, light-colored stools, joint pain, and jaundice. Treatment of hepatitis depends on the underlying etiology. Adenoviruses are doubled-stranded DNA viruses that spread by close personal contact, respiratory droplets, and fomites. There are more than 50 types of immunologically distinct adenoviruses that can cause infections in humans. Adenoviruses most commonly cause respiratory illness. However, some adenovirus types can cause other illnesses, such as gastroenteritis, conjunctivitis, cystitis, and, less commonly, neurological disease.

There is no specific treatment for adenovirus infections. Adenovirus type 41 commonly causes pediatric acute gastroenteritis, which typically presents as diarrhea, vomiting, and fever; it can often be accompanied by respiratory symptoms. While there have been case reports of hepatitis in immunocompromised children with adenovirus type 41 infection, adenovirus type 41 is not known to be a cause of hepatitis in otherwise healthy children.

Recommendations
  1. Clinicians should consider adenovirus testing in pediatric patients with hepatitis of unknown etiology. NAAT (e.g., PCR) is preferable and may be done on respiratory specimens, stool or rectal swabs, or blood.
  2. Anecdotal reports suggest that testing whole blood by PCR may be more sensitive than testing plasma by PCR; therefore, testing of whole blood could be considered in those without an etiology who tested negative for adenovirus in plasma samples.
  3. If patients are still under medical care or have residual specimens available, please save and freeze specimens for possible additional testing and contact DHS at 608-267-9003.
Clinical Criteria for Case Reporting
  1. Children under age 16, presenting with hepatitis of unknown etiology (with or without any adenovirus testing results) since January 1, 2021, AND
  2. Elevated liver function tests (i.e., aspartate aminotransferase (AST) or alanine aminotransferase (ALT) >500 U/L).
Suspect cases should be reported to public health electronically via the Wisconsin Electronic Disease Surveillance System (WEDSS) and selecting “hepatitis unknown” as the disease type, or by contacting DHS at 608-267-9003.

Acute Hepatitis and Adenovirus Infection Among Children — Alabama, October 2021–February 2022

During October–November 2021, clinicians at a children’s hospital in Alabama identified five pediatric patients with severe hepatitis and adenovirus viremia upon admission. In November 2021, hospital clinicians, the Alabama Department of Public Health, the Jefferson County Department of Health, and CDC began an investigation. This activity was reviewed by CDC and conducted consistent with applicable federal law and CDC policy.*

Clinical records from the hospital were reviewed to identify patients seen on or after October 1, 2021, with hepatitis and an adenovirus infection, detected via real-time polymerase chain reaction (PCR) testing on whole blood specimens, and no other known cause for hepatitis. An additional four children were identified, for a total of nine patients with hepatitis of unknown etiology and concomitant adenovirus infection during October 2021–February 2022. On February 1, 2022, a statewide health advisory[SUP]†[/SUP] was disseminated to aid in the identification of cases at other facilities in Alabama; no additional patients were identified.

All nine children were patients at Children’s of Alabama. These patients were from geographically distinct parts of the state; no epidemiologic links among patients were identified. The median age at admission was 2 years, 11 months (IQR = 1 year, 8 months to 5 years, 9 months) and seven patients were female (Table). All patients were immunocompetent with no clinically significant medical comorbidities.

Before admission, among the nine patients, vomiting, diarrhea, and upper respiratory symptoms were reported by seven, six, and three patients, respectively. At admission, eight patients had scleral icterus, seven had hepatomegaly, six had jaundice, and one had encephalopathy (Table). Elevated transaminases were detected among all patients[SUP]§[/SUP] (alanine aminotransferase [ALT] range = 603–4,696 U/L; aspartate aminotransferase [AST] range = 447–4,000 U/L); total bilirubin ranged from normal to elevated (range = 0.23–13.5 mg/dL, elevated in eight patients). All patients received negative test results for hepatitis viruses A, B, and C, and several other causes of pediatric hepatitis and infections were ruled out including autoimmune hepatitis, Wilson disease, bacteremia, urinary tract infections, and SARS-CoV-2 infection. None of the children had documented history of previous SARS-CoV-2 infection.

Adenovirus was detected in whole blood specimens from all patients by real-time PCR testing (initial viral load range = 991–70,680 copies/mL). Hexon gene hypervariable region sequencing was performed on specimens from five patients, and adenovirus type 41 was detected in all five specimens. Low viral loads precluded sequencing among three patients, and residual specimens were not available for sequencing for one patient. Seven patients were coinfected with other viral pathogens (Table). Six received positive test results for Epstein-Barr virus (EBV) by PCR testing but negative test results for EBV immunoglobulin M (IgM) antibodies (one patient did not have IgM testing), suggesting that these were likely not acute infections but rather low-level reactivation of previous infections. Other detected viruses included enterovirus/rhinovirus, metapneumovirus, respiratory syncytial virus, and human coronavirus OC43.

Liver biopsies from six patients demonstrated various degrees of hepatitis with no viral inclusions observed, no immunohistochemical evidence of adenovirus, or no viral particles identified by electron microscopy. Three patients developed acute liver failure, two of whom were treated with cidofovir (off-label use) and steroids, and were transferred to a different medical facility where they underwent liver transplantation. Plasma specimens from these two patients were negative for adenovirus by real-time PCR testing upon arrival at the receiving medical facility, but both patients received positive test results when retested by the same real-time PCR test using a whole blood specimen. All patients have recovered or are recovering, including the two transplant recipients.

Adenovirus type 41 is primarily spread via the fecal-oral route and predominantly affects the gut. It is a common cause of pediatric acute gastroenteritis typically with diarrhea, vomiting and fever, often accompanied by respiratory symptoms (1). Adenovirus is recognized as a cause of hepatitis among immunocompromised children (2). It might be an underrecognized contributor to liver injury among healthy children (3); however, the magnitude of this relationship remains under investigation.

This cluster, along with recently identified possible cases in Europe (46), suggests that adenovirus should be considered in the differential diagnosis of acute hepatitis of unknown etiology among children. Clinicians and laboratorians should be aware of possible differences in adenovirus test sensitivity for different specimen types; tests using whole blood might be more sensitive than those using plasma. CDC is monitoring the situation closely to understand the possible cause of illness and identify potential efforts to prevent or mitigate illness. Enhanced surveillance is underway in coordination with jurisdictional public health partners. Clinicians are encouraged to report possible cases of pediatric hepatitis with unknown etiology occurring on or after October 1, 2021, to public health authorities for further investigation.[SUP]¶[/SUP]

Proactive Statement: MMWR on children with acute hepatitis and adenovirus infection in Alabama

A new study published by the Centers for Disease Control and Prevention (CDC) today, “Acute Hepatitis and Adenovirus Infection Among Children — Alabama, October 2021–February 2022” provides additional clinical and epidemiologic information from an ongoing investigation involving children in Alabama with hepatitis (inflammation of the liver) of unknown cause.

These findings build on previous information shared about the cluster of nine cases currently under investigation by CDC and the Alabama Department of Public Health. In the fall of 2021, clinicians at a children’s hospital in Alabama identified five patients with severe hepatitis and adenovirus infection, including some with acute liver failure. A review of hospital clinical records identified four additional cases, all of whom had liver injury and adenovirus infection. All were previously healthy, ranged in age from about 1 to 6-years-old, and had no significant underlying conditions.

Among the findings in the MMWR: two of the pediatric patients in Alabama required liver transplants, and three developed liver failure, but all have since recovered or are recovering. Prior to hospitalization, most of the children experienced vomiting and diarrhea, while some experienced upper respiratory symptoms. During hospitalization, most had yellowing eyes, yellowing skin (or jaundice), and an enlarged liver. All nine patients tested positive for adenovirus, and six tested positive for Epstein-Barr Virus but did not have antibodies, which implies an earlier, not active infection. Laboratory tests identified that some of these children had adenovirus type 41, which more commonly causes pediatric acute gastroenteritis. Additionally, some showed a history of other viruses including enterovirus/rhinovirus, metapneumovirus, respiratory syntactical virus, and human coronavirus OC43.

At this time, we believe adenovirus may be the cause for these reported cases, but other potential environmental and situational factors are still being investigated. Adenovirus type 41 is not usually known as a cause of hepatitis in otherwise healthy children, and no known epidemiological link or common exposures among these children has been found. Some causes have already been ruled out, including:
  • hepatitis viruses A, B, and C
  • SARS-CoV-2 infection
  • autoimmune hepatitis
  • Wilson disease
It’s important to note that this report is specific to the Alabama investigation, and CDC does not have an update at this time on any other suspected cases in the U.S. CDC is taking every potential reported case seriously and working vigilantly with state and local public health officials and clinicians to identify and investigate other potential cases. On April 21, CDC issued a nationwide Health Alert Network (HAN) Advisory asking all physicians to be on the lookout for symptoms and to report any suspected cases of hepatitis of unknown origin to their local and state health departments. CDC is working with commercial and state public health laboratories to provide guidance on how to submit testing.

CDC is also aware of an increase in cases of pediatric hepatitis without a known cause recently reported in Europe, and has been in contact with our European counterparts to understand what they are learning. Adenovirus has been confirmed in several of the European cases, but not all. Investigators are ruling out other possible causes and identifying other possible contributing factors. As we learn more, we will share additional information and updates.
 
Increase in hepatitis (liver inflammation) cases in children under investigation


Regular UKHSA updates on the ongoing investigation into higher than usual rates of liver inflammation (hepatitis) in children across the UK.

From:UK Health Security Agency

Published 6 April 2022
Last updated 29 April 2022 — See all updates
ukhsa-master-logo-960x640-grey.jpg



Latest


The UK Health Security Agency (UKHSA), working with Public Health Scotland, Public Health Wales and the Public Health Agency, are continuing to investigate the cases of sudden onset hepatitis in children aged 10 and under that have been identified since January 2022.

The usual viruses that cause infectious hepatitis (hepatitis A to E) have not been detected. The cases are predominantly in children under 5 years old who showed initial symptoms of gastroenteritis illness (diarrhoea and nausea) followed by the onset of jaundice.

Active case finding investigations have identified a further 34 confirmed cases since the last update on 25 April, bringing the total number of cases to 145. Of the confirmed cases, 108 are resident in England, 17 are in Scotland, 11 are in Wales and 9 are in Northern Ireland.

Of these cases, 10 children have received a liver transplant. No children have died. As part of the investigation, a small number of children over the age of 10 are also being investigated.

Findings continue to suggest that the rise in sudden onset hepatitis in children may be linked to adenovirus infection, but other causes are still being actively investigated.

As it is not typical to see this pattern of symptoms from adenovirus, we are investigating other possible contributing factors, such as another infection – including coronavirus (COVID-19) – or an environmental cause.

We are also exploring whether increased susceptibility due to reduced exposure during the COVID-19 pandemic could be playing a role, or if there has been a change in the genome of the adenovirus.

UKHSA is working with scientists and clinicians across the country to answer these questions as quickly as possible.

Dr Meera Chand, Director of Clinical and Emerging Infections at UKHSA, said:
We know that this may be a concerning time for parents of young children. The likelihood of your child developing hepatitis is extremely low. However, we continue to remind parents to be alert to the signs of hepatitis – particularly jaundice, which is easiest to spot as a yellow tinge in the whites of the eyes – and contact your doctor if you are concerned.

Normal hygiene measures, including thorough handwashing and making sure children wash their hands properly, help to reduce the spread of many common infections.

As always, children experiencing symptoms such as vomiting and diarrhoea should stay at home and not return to school or nursery until 48 hours after the symptoms have stopped.

Q&A - Acute severe hepatitis in children
3 May 2022


On 15 April 2022, the World Health Organization (WHO) published an alert on severe acute hepatitis cases of unknown origin in children in the United Kingdom. Since then, there have been continuing additional reports of cases.
We spoke with Dr. Leandro Soares Sereno, Advisor for Viral Hepatitis Prevention and Control at the Pan American Health Organization (PAHO), about hepatitis, and the severe acute cases reported in a number of countries.

1. What is acute hepatitis?

Hepatitis is an inflammation of the liver. There are different aetiologies – or causes – that can lead to this inflammation, such as an infection or intoxication by drugs or substances. The most frequently implicated infectious agents are the viruses responsible for hepatitis A, B, C, D and E.
When inflammation occurs rapidly and abruptly, we speak of acute hepatitis. In some cases, as in hepatitis B, C and D, the infection may become chronic. In this situation, we are not yet sure of the cause.

2. Why is the outbreak of hepatitis in children considered unusual? Is it due to the adenovirus?

This is an event under further investigation by WHO. So far, laboratory tests exclude cases of known viral hepatitis. In many cases, adenovirus infection was detected in the affected children, and the link between the two is being investigated as one of the hypotheses for the underlying cause.
Adenovirus is a common virus that can cause respiratory symptoms or vomiting and diarrhea. In general, the infection with such viruses is of limited duration and does not evolve into more serious conditions. There have been rare cases, however, of severe adenovirus infections that have caused hepatitis in immunocompromised- or transplant patients, for example. However, these children don’t match that description – they were previously healthy.

3. How many countries have reported confirmed or suspected cases of hepatitis in children that are not linked to hepatitis viruses A, B, C, D or E?

We cannot speak of confirmed cases at this point because the specific cause is still unknown and under investigation. The reported cases refer to children with severe acute hepatitis where hepatitis A, B, C, D or E were not identified.
Using this definition, as May 3, 2022, over 200 cases have been reported from 20 countries. The vast majority of cases are in the United Kingdom, which was the first country to report cases to WHO.
In the Americas, cases have been reported in the United States, and countries in the region are advised to monitor the situation. For now, PAHO/WHO is providing information to countries about criteria and definitions to assist in monitoring.

4. What is PAHO's assessment of the situation?

There is still little data to define whether there is an outbreak, and for now the global risk is considered low. As there is still no certainty about the origin of the disease, it is possible that we are becoming aware of a situation that existed before but went unnoticed because there were so few cases.

5. Could the outbreak be linked to COVID-19 or COVID-19 vaccines?

Based on current information, most of the reported children did not receive the COVID-19 vaccine, ruling out a link between cases and vaccination at this time.
In a few cases, the presence of the SARS-CoV-2 virus was detected, and this is one of the lines of investigation along with others such as the adenovirus.

6. What are the symptoms? Is it treatable?

Acute hepatitis has different symptoms: gastrointestinal, such as diarrhea or vomiting, fever and muscle pain, but the most characteristic is jaundice – where the skin and the whites of the eyes turn yellow.
The current treatment seeks to alleviate symptoms, and to manage and stabilize the patient if the case is severe. Treatment recommendations can be refined once the origin of infection is determined.

7. What can parents do to protect children?

The most important is to pay attention to symptoms, such as diarrhea or vomiting, and to the color: if there are signs of jaundice – where the skin and whites of the eyes turn yellow – medical attention should be sought immediately.
We recommend basic hygiene measures such as washing hands and covering your mouth when coughing or sneezing to prevent infections, which can also guard against the transmission of adenoviruses.

8. What measures does PAHO recommend to prevent the spread of the disease?

At this time, the recommendation to countries is to stay informed and to monitor for cases. The origin of cases remains under study, and PAHO/WHO will continue to provide technical support to countries in the region in generating and disseminating information during the course of the investigation.

Acute hepatitis of unknown origin: update of May 4, 2022


Published on :
Wednesday, May 4, 2022

There are currently 3 cases of acute liver inflammation in Belgium that meet the case definition to report to the European Center for Disease Prevention and Control ( ECDC ), as part of the investigation into the extent and cause of this condition. These are children who fell ill between February and April.

In addition, a number of older cases (since October 1, 2021) have been reviewed. This revealed 2 other possible cases. These are cases that may meet the case definition, but for which no conclusion can be drawn because further laboratory examinations are no longer possible.

The age of these cases varies between 1 month and 10 years.

The search for new possible cases continues. We are still waiting for new notifications, but for the moment it seems that the disease is rare in Belgium. We don't yet know if there is a common cause or if the condition is caused by a virus.

Except for good hand hygiene, no special precautions are necessary.

Four suspected cases of hepatitis

Portugal has four suspected cases of acute hepatitis of unknown origin in children, aged 7 months to 8 years, announced the Directorate General of Health (DGS).

By TPN/Lusa, in News , Portugal , Health · 3 hours ago · 0 Comments


The four suspected cases were identified in the North, Center and Lisbon and Tagus Valley health regions and all tested negative for hepatitis A, B and C and for the SARS-CoV-2 virus, the results for hepatitis E being still awaited in two cases, reveals the DGS in a press release.

According to the health authority, one of the cases has already tested positive for the adenovirus, and the sample has been sent for sequencing to the National Institute of Health Dr. Ricardo Jorge.

"The children presented symptoms in April and were hospitalized, but none had serious complications, having recovered from the clinical picture", indicates the health authority, pointing out that epidemiological factors such as travel or connections between the cases are being investigated, in collaboration with the Ministry of Health and the European Center for Disease Prevention and Control (ECDC).

In the context of the international epidemic, a "taskforce" has been set up by the DGS, which includes specialists from the Portuguese Society of Pediatrics (SPP).

On April 15, the World Health Organization issued an alert about the increase in the number of cases of severe acute hepatitis in healthy children.

So far, the highest number of cases have occurred in Europe, particularly the UK, and were most common in children aged 3 to 5 years.

An update on acute hepatitis identified in children
On April 15, 2022, the World Health Organization (WHO) published a report to describe the cluster of cases of acute hepatitis of unknown origin in children in the United Kingdom. Since then, other cases have been reported. What data is available so far?​

May 05, 2022 - 4:28 p.m. | By INSERM PRESS OFFICE

So far, five viruses have been identified as capable of causing hepatitis. On April 15, 2022, the World Health Organization (WHO) published a report to describe the cluster of cases of acute hepatitis of unknown origin in children in the United Kingdom. Since then, more cases have been reported, in a total of 16 countries. While the prevalence of this disease remains very rare – around 200 cases have been identified worldwide – the clusters that have formed in several places are unusual and raise questions for the scientific community.

It is not yet clear whether there has really been an increase in cases of pediatric hepatitis or an increase in awareness of cases that were previously undetected or poorly detected and are now better identified thanks to to enhanced monitoring.

The track of an infection by an adenovirus which would cause the disease is privileged. In the United Kingdom, for example, nearly 80% of the cases described at the end of April had indeed tested positive for an adenovirus.

To read also to go further:

A study published by the Centers for Disease Control (CDC) in the United States looked at nine cases of pediatric hepatitis with varying degrees of severity, described in Alabama between October 2021 and February 2022. PCR tests revealed the presence of an adenovirus in each of the nine children, but seven patients were also co-infected with other viruses.


However, this adenovirus trail is not yet confirmed – the presence of a specific virus in patients does not necessarily imply a causal link with hepatitis and other as yet unidentified factors that could potentially be as well. in question. The investigations are continuing.

Canal Détox returns to the main questions raised in the media in recent days.

What is hepatitis?

Hepatitis is an inflammation of the liver of viral origin in the majority of cases, although the disease can sometimes be caused by toxic substances. So far five viruses have been identified as capable of causing this targeted liver infection and inflammation. They are designated by the letters A, B, C, D and E, and do not have the same mode of transmission or the same aggressiveness.

Some forms of hepatitis can become chronic: they last more than six months. Common causes of this chronicity include hepatitis B and C viruses, non-alcoholic steatohepatitis (or NASH), alcohol-related liver disease, and autoimmune liver disease (autoimmune hepatitis). ). The cases reported in recent weeks in children are acute hepatitis: patients recover even if in 10% of cases the lesions were severe and required a liver transplant.

Care and treatment differ depending on the origin of the hepatitis. Currently, chronic hepatitis C is unique in that it is the only chronic viral disease that can be cured.

Some forms of hepatitis are called “non-alphabetic” because the A, B, C, D or E viruses are not found in patients. These “non-alphabetic” viruses can be responsible for hepatitis of varying severity depending on the terrain. This is what seems to be taking shape here, even if the data is still patchy.

What are adenoviruses?

Adenoviruses are a family of envelopeless DNA viruses. Over 80 types of adenovirus are known to infect humans. Some adenoviruses are also the cause of zoonoses .

Adenovirus 41, which has been identified in several of the hepatitis cases in recent weeks, is already well known as a cause of gastroenteritis in children. In general, the target cells of adenoviruses are mainly located in the conjunctiva and the digestive, respiratory and urinary tracts.

Is there a link with the Covid-19 pandemic?

Some commentators quickly mentioned a link between these pediatric hepatitis and Covid-19. But while some of the children were co-infected with SARS-CoV-2 when the hepatitis broke out, not all of them. Additional studies on the subject are therefore necessary to see more clearly.

On the other hand, in the face of claims that vaccination could be involved, it should be noted that the vast majority of the children concerned were too young to have been vaccinated.

Finally, some hypotheses suggest that children could be more sensitive to adenoviruses, due to their lower circulation during confinement, or that a more virulent adenovirus could be responsible for hepatitis, but work still needs to be done. to confirm or refute these theses.

North Dakota Department of Health Investigating Hepatitis in Child with Unknown Cause

The North Dakota Department of Health (NDDoH) is working with the Centers for Disease Control and Prevention (CDC) in investigating a child with hepatitis of unknown cause. The child resides in Grand Forks County. The child is recovering at home after a brief hospitalization. North Dakota is among a growing list of states investigating children with hepatitis where usual causes have been ruled out.

“We are encouraging medical providers to review their records back to October 2021 for any patients that warrant further investigation,” said Kirby Kruger, Medical Services Section Chief. “NDDoH is working with the CDC to help identify cases that will aid in understanding the cause of hepatitis in children and to understand how we can prevent these illnesses from happening in the future.”

Parents are encouraged to watch for symptoms of hepatitis, or inflammation of the liver. These symptoms include fever, fatigue, loss of appetite, nausea, vomiting, abdominal pain, dark urine, light-colored stools, and jaundice, or yellow skin or eyes. Talk to your medical provider if your child is experiencing these symptoms.

A link between cases of hepatitis and adenovirus infection has been suggested. Because of this, CDC is asking physicians to consider adenovirus testing. Adenovirus infections are common and occur among persons of all ages. Symptoms may include cold-like symptoms, fever, sore throat, pneumonia, diarrhea, or pink eye.

NDDoH encourages everyday precautions to keep children safe, including washing hands often, staying home when ill, avoiding people who are sick, covering coughs and sneezes, avoiding touching the eyes, nose, or mouth, and staying up-to-date on routinely recommended vaccines.

Pet dogs being investigated as the cause of mystery hepatitis outbreak in children
6 May 2022, 17:59
By Liam Gould

Pet dogs are being investigated as a potential cause of the hepatitis outbreak that's been affecting children around the world.

The UK Health Security Agency (UKHSA) said the "significance of this finding is being explored".

They said a "high" number of children that tested positive for the disease - all aged 10 or under - come from families who own a dog, or have been exposed to a dog.

Officials gave families of infected children questionnaires to help in identifying the cause of the illness. One of the responses found 70 per cent — 64 of 92 respondents — owned a dog or had been exposed to a dog.

But, health officials said the 'common' ownership of dogs might make the findings a coincidence. Around half of UK adults own a pet, figures suggest.

Nearly 300 cases have now been detected across the world in over 20 countries, World Health Organisation figures suggest. One death has been confirmed, while four are under investigation...
